Oracle 将Struts2应用部署到Weblogic 12c

Oracle 将Struts2应用部署到Weblogic 12c

在本文中,我们将介绍如何将Struts2应用部署到Oracle Weblogic 12c服务器。首先,让我们先了解一下Struts2和Weblogic 12c的概念。

阅读更多:Oracle 教程

什么是Struts2和Weblogic 12c?

Struts2是一个开源的基于Java的Web应用框架,它可以帮助开发者更轻松地构建可扩展和可维护的Web应用程序。它采用了MVC(模型-视图-控制器)设计模式,提供了易于使用的标签库,以及对表单验证和数据绑定的强大支持。

Weblogic 12c是Oracle提供的一款企业级Java应用服务器。它提供了可靠的、高度可扩展的平台,用于部署和管理Java应用程序。Weblogic 12c支持Java EE标准,并提供了许多高级功能,如负载均衡、故障转移和分布式计算。

在Weblogic 12c上部署Struts2应用的步骤

步骤一:准备工作

在部署Struts2应用之前,您需要完成以下准备工作:

  • 安装Java Development Kit(JDK)并设置JAVA_HOME环境变量。
  • 下载并安装Weblogic 12c服务器。

步骤二:创建Weblogic域

Weblogic域是Weblogic服务器的管理单元。在部署Struts2应用之前,您需要创建一个Weblogic域。以下是创建Weblogic域的步骤:

  1. 打开Weblogic域创建向导。
  2. 选择创建一个新的域,并指定域的名称和位置。
  3. 配置域的管理服务器和日志设置。
  4. 完成向导,创建Weblogic域。

步骤三:创建数据库资源和JDBC连接池

Struts2应用通常需要与数据库进行交互。在Weblogic 12c上部署Struts2应用之前,您需要创建数据库资源和JDBC连接池。以下是创建数据库资源和JDBC连接池的步骤:

  1. 打开Weblogic域的管理控制台。
  2. 导航到“服务->JDBC->JDBC数据源”。
  3. 创建一个新的数据源,配置数据库连接信息。
  4. 导航到“服务->JDBC->JDBC连接池”。
  5. 创建一个新的连接池,关联之前创建的数据源。

步骤四:配置Struts2应用

在将Struts2应用部署到Weblogic 12c之前,您需要编辑应用的配置文件。以下是配置Struts2应用的步骤:

  1. 打开Struts2应用的的配置文件(通常是struts.xml)。
  2. 配置数据库连接信息,指定之前创建的JDBC连接池。
  3. 配置其他应用相关的设置,如国际化资源和拦截器配置。

步骤五:打包并部署Struts2应用

一旦您完成了Struts2应用的配置,接下来就可以将其打包并部署到Weblogic 12c。以下是打包并部署Struts2应用的步骤:

  1. 使用构建工具(如Maven)将Struts2应用打包成WAR文件。
  2. 打开Weblogic域的管理控制台。
  3. 导航到“部署”页面。
  4. 上传应用的WAR文件,然后启动部署。

总结

本文介绍了如何将Struts2应用部署到Weblogic 12c服务器。通过遵循上述步骤,您可以轻松地将您的Struts2应用部署到Weblogic 12c,并利用Weblogic 12c提供的高级功能来管理和扩展您的应用。希望本文对您有所帮助!

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程